Definition of Permissionless Lending
Permissionless lending is a decentralized financial system where users can borrow and lend digital assets without needing approval from a central authority. It leverages blockchain technology and smart contracts to facilitate transactions transparently and autonomously.
Background on Permissionless Lending
Traditional financial systems rely on banks and centralized institutions to mediate lending and borrowing. With blockchain and DeFi innovations, permissionless lending emerged as an alternative, removing intermediaries and enabling global, borderless access to capital.

How Does It Work? (With Examples)
Permissionless lending operates through smart contracts, which automatically enforce loan agreements. Here are two real-world examples:
- Aave
- Users deposit assets into a liquidity pool.
- Borrowers take loans by providing collateral.
- Interest rates are algorithmically determined based on supply and demand.
- If collateral value falls below a threshold, the loan is liquidated to protect lenders.
- Compound
- Users supply assets and receive cTokens in return, representing their deposit.
- Interest accrues in real-time, increasing the value of cTokens.
- Borrowers use their deposits as collateral to take out loans in different assets.
Simple Analogy
Imagine a neighborhood library where anyone can lend or borrow books without a librarian. Instead of asking permission, borrowers leave a valuable item (collateral) in case they don’t return the book. If they fail to return it, the item is kept. This system runs on trust and automation, similar to permissionless lending.

Who Uses It?
- Retail Investors: Earn passive income by lending their assets.
- Borrowers: Obtain loans without credit checks or banking restrictions.
- Institutions & Businesses: Use liquidity pools for financial strategies and operations.
- DeFi Platforms: Provide lending and borrowing services via smart contracts.
Challenges
- Smart Contract Risks: Bugs and exploits can lead to loss of funds.
- Regulatory Uncertainty: Governments are still defining policies around DeFi.
- Liquidation Risks: Volatility in crypto markets can cause sudden liquidations.
